For example in WOW i'll be running at 80fps then 5 mins later it'll drop to 8fps & so on & so forth
As far as I'm aware there are no connections between Latency and FPS?

That would be solely hardware related unless I'm wrong and could be caused by countless problems on a standard desktop.

the most common latency problem with WoW is a persistent problem which pops up every so often for UK players all over the country. They reach pings of over 3000ms when trying to play. There are fixes for this which I have posted in another WoW related thread. For now though that issue is resolved for most.
